    This issue emerged after the WordPress 5.5 update. First, we had some of the widgets on the home page were disabled, then some pages got jumbled. Through some help from the StudioPress support, I installed Enable jQuery Migrate Helper plugin which solved the problem. After the site settled down, I started doing some troubleshooting. If the plugin is disabled the images do no show in a lightbox overlay but open as new content. If I enable the plugin, which is enabled now, the images display in an overlay.

    I tried using different lightbox plugins from our standard Easy Fancybox, which did not make any difference. I have disabled all lightbox plugins and using the built-in Fancybox overlay from NextGEN Other options, Lightbox effects. Currently:

    1. There is no additional lightbox plugin
    2. The Enable jQuery Migrate Helper is active

    so that the site can perform as expected by the visitors.

    I wonder if the issue is related to and triggered by NextGEN Gallery. Any help will be much appreciated.

    If I go to customize/Theme Settings/Header Footer Scripts and remove the following block:

    <script async defer src=”https://maps.googleapis.com/maps/api/js?key=AIzaSyA-z3MqAiGo7UsK46Jyms7BYUjM-TKQPns&callback=initMap&#8221;
    type=”text/javascript”></script>

    The above error block disappears. But, I do not know whether that takes care of the problem or simply hides the error messages. I provide these pieces of information with the hope that they may add more hints to the pool.
